The "Take a copy of your results" option can be used to save the score in Markup text, forum-ready format or a reddit-friendly format. UserBenchmark will identify the model of your CPU, Graphics card, Storage drives, memory modules (RAM) and rank them according to their performance in the benchmark tests, and how they fared against other computers. Refer to this page if you want to know more about these. These are the service's classifications or nicknames which indicate how powerful your computer is. You will see odd names like Sailboat, Jet Ski, etc. UserBenchmark ranks the computer in three categories: Gaming, Desktop and Workstation. When the benchmark is completed, a new tab is opened in your browser with the results. The only way to end it is by killing the process. Once started, a benchmark cannot be interrupted, i.e. Hit the run button to begin the benchmarking process. Even a single browser tab/window can affect the score. Make sure you don't have any applications running in the background while running the benchmark for best results. If you have an SSD, run the program from it.
